The UK Gambling Commission's Rules on Credit Card Casinos

The U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) introduced a ban on credit card gambling in April 2020. The regulation was designed to protect vulnerable players from accumulating debt while funding gambling activities. Under this rule, any UKGC-licensed operator โ€” whether a land-based venue or an online platform โ€” is prohibited from accepting deposits made directly via credit cards. This effectively redefined what people mean when they search for credit card casinos in the UK context.

This means that players based in the United Kingdom cannot use a Visa credit card, a Mastercard credit card, or any other credit-based product to fund a casino account on a licensed platform. Debit cards, however, remain fully permitted. Visa Debit and Mastercard Debit are both widely accepted across virtually every regulated UK casino site.

โš ๏ธ Important: Offshore Casino Warning

The ban applies only to licensed UK operators. Some offshore casinos โ€” licensed in Malta, Curaรงao, or Gibraltar โ€” may still accept credit cards. However, these sites operate outside UKGC oversight, meaning players have fewer protections. Our advice is always to stick with UKGC-licensed platforms and never gamble money you cannot afford to lose.

Some players use credit cards indirectly by loading funds into a digital wallet such as PayPal, Skrill, or Neteller and then depositing from that wallet into their casino account. This workaround is technically permitted by the casino's payment system, though it still involves spending borrowed money, which carries inherent financial risk.

What "Low Fee" Actually Means at Online Casinos

When we talk about low-fee casinos, we are referring to platforms that minimise the hidden costs associated with depositing and withdrawing funds. These costs can include deposit processing fees, withdrawal charges, currency conversion fees, and the minimum or maximum transaction limits that effectively restrict how you manage your bankroll.

Here is a breakdown of the most common fee types you may encounter:

  • Deposit fees: Most reputable UK casinos charge zero deposit fees for debit card transactions. A fee of 1%โ€“3% would be considered high and is a red flag worth noting.
  • Withdrawal fees: Some platforms charge a flat fee (e.g., ยฃ2โ€“ยฃ5) per withdrawal or a percentage of the total. Look for casinos that offer at least one free withdrawal method per week.
  • Currency conversion fees: If your account is held in GBP and the casino processes in a different currency, you may face conversion charges. Always confirm your account currency before depositing.
  • Inactivity fees: Dormant accounts are sometimes subject to monthly maintenance charges. Read the terms and conditions carefully before registering.
  • E-wallet surcharges: Occasionally, casinos apply different fee structures for e-wallet deposits compared to card deposits. Verify this before choosing your preferred payment method.

A genuinely low-fee casino will be transparent about all of these charges in its cashier section or help centre. If you have to dig through multiple pages of terms to find the fee structure, that is not a good sign.

Debit Cards vs E-Wallets: Which Is Better for Casino Banking?

One of the most common questions from players exploring their options on regulated platforms is whether to use a debit card or an e-wallet for their casino transactions. Both have merits, and the best choice often depends on your personal priorities.

Debit cards (Visa Debit / Mastercard Debit) are the most straightforward option. They are universally accepted at UKGC-licensed casinos, require no additional account setup, and offer instant deposits. Withdrawals typically take one to three business days to arrive in your bank account. Because debit card transactions are linked directly to your bank, they also appear clearly on your statement, which can be helpful for tracking your gambling spend as part of responsible gambling habits. This makes them the logical successor to the credit card casinos model that UK players were accustomed to before the 2020 ban.

E-wallets such as PayPal, Skrill, and Neteller offer faster withdrawals โ€” often within hours โ€” and add an extra layer of separation between your bank account and casino account. However, e-wallets sometimes disqualify users from welcome bonuses, as some casinos exclude e-wallet deposits from promotional offers. Additionally, a small number of casinos do charge a fee for e-wallet transactions, though this is becoming less common.

For most UK players, using a Visa Debit or Mastercard Debit card is the simplest and most cost-effective approach for standard casino banking. E-wallets are worth considering if you prioritise faster withdrawals or want an extra degree of financial privacy.

How to Spot a Reputable Low-Fee Casino

Not all casinos that advertise "zero fees" actually deliver on that promise. Some platforms bury surcharges in their terms and conditions or apply restrictive withdrawal limits. Here is what to check before committing to any platform:

  1. UKGC Licence: Always verify that the casino holds a valid UK Gambling Commission licence. A licence number should be displayed in the casino's footer.
  2. Clear Fee Schedule: A reputable casino will publish its deposit and withdrawal fees clearly in the cashier section or a dedicated banking FAQ.
  3. Reasonable Withdrawal Limits: Look for casinos with daily or weekly withdrawal limits that match your playing style.
  4. Multiple Payment Methods: A good casino offers at least three to five payment options, giving you flexibility.
  5. Responsive Customer Support: Test the live chat or email support before depositing.
  6. Transparent Terms and Conditions: Read the bonus terms carefully. Some welcome offers come with stringent wagering requirements.
  7. Independent Reviews: Check platforms like Trustpilot for independent player feedback about withdrawal speed and fee transparency.

It is also worth checking whether the casino's cashier page uses SSL encryption โ€” look for the padlock icon in your browser's address bar and ensure the URL begins with https. Reputable casinos display their security credentials clearly, often at the bottom of the cashier page alongside responsible gambling logos and payment method icons.

Responsible Gambling and Managing Your Casino Budget

One of the most important aspects of any discussion about casino banking is responsible gambling. The UK Gambling Commission requires all licensed operators to provide a comprehensive suite of responsible gambling tools, and understanding how to use these tools is just as important as finding the right payment method. This is especially relevant for players who previously used credit card casinos and are now transitioning to debit-based or e-wallet payment methods.

Here are the key responsible gambling features available at all UKGC-licensed casinos:

๐Ÿ›ก๏ธ Your Responsible Gambling Toolkit

  • Deposit limits: Set daily, weekly, or monthly caps on how much you can deposit.
  • Loss limits: Cap the amount you can lose within a given period.
  • Session time limits: Set a maximum amount of time you can spend playing per day.
  • Reality checks: Pop-up notifications that appear at regular intervals to remind you how long you have been playing.
  • Self-exclusion: Register with GAMSTOP to exclude yourself from all UKGC-licensed operators simultaneously.
  • Cool-off periods: Lock your account for 24 hours, 48 hours, or one week to give you time to reflect.

If you are concerned about your gambling behaviour, organisations like GamCare, BeGambleAware, and Gambling Therapy offer free, confidential support. Remember: gambling should always be a form of entertainment, never a means of generating income or escaping financial difficulty.

From a budgeting perspective, the combination of low-fee casino banking and responsible gambling tools gives UK players excellent control over their finances. Using a debit card rather than a credit card means you can only spend money you actually have. Setting deposit limits reinforces this discipline further. On most casino platforms, these limit settings are accessible directly from the account menu, and changes to reduction limits take effect immediately, while requests to increase limits are subject to a 24-hour cooling-off period as required by UKGC regulations.
